:: Christopher Hitchens has died: Outspoken atheist writer and public intellectual Christopher Hitchens died on Thursday night. Doug Wilson, his old debate partner, has written a fantastic obituary you really must read. Seriously, go read it right now. Justin Taylor also has a good blog post, including a video highlighting a scene with Hitchens talking to Wilson in a car, discussing what he thinks are the strengths of the Theistic worldview and why he wouldn't exactly wish for a world completely free from religion.
